Pasture Dream Meaning

Dreaming of a pasture is often associated with feelings of contentment, peace, and relaxation. It can also symbolize abundance, fertility, and growth. The dream may be a sign that you are in need of some rest and relaxation or that you are feeling overwhelmed by the demands of life.

The dream may also be a sign that you are ready to take on new challenges and opportunities. It could be an indication that you are ready to move forward in your life and make positive changes.

Abundance

Dreaming of a lush green pasture can be a sign of abundance in your life. It could mean that you have plenty of resources available to you and that you are able to enjoy the fruits of your labor. This dream could also be a sign that you are feeling content with your current situation.

Fertility

Dreaming of a pasture can also symbolize fertility. It could mean that you are ready to start something new or embark on a new journey. This dream could also be an indication that you are ready to take on new responsibilities or create something meaningful.

Growth

Dreaming of a pasture can also signify growth and progress. It could mean that you are making strides towards achieving your goals and that you are feeling confident about the future. This dream could also be an indication that you are ready to take on new challenges and opportunities.

Peace

Dreaming of a peaceful pasture can be a sign of inner peace and tranquility. It could mean that you have found balance in your life and that you are feeling content with where you are at this moment in time. This dream could also be an indication that you have found harmony within yourself.

Relaxation

Dreaming of a tranquil pasture can be a sign of relaxation and rejuvenation. It could mean that you need some time away from the hustle and bustle of everyday life to recharge your batteries. This dream could also be an indication that it is time for some self-care.
